Karsten Danzmann – Winner of the Körber European Science Prize 2017

The German physicist and his team have developed the key technologies with which direct evidence of gravitational waves was provided in the USA for the first time in 2015. Astronomers have thus literally opened a new window to the cosmos, as they were previously able to explore the universe only by means of electromagnetic waves – light, radio waves, X-rays or gamma rays. For these ground-breaking findings in gravitational wave research, Karsten Danzmann has been awarded the Körber European Science Prize 2017.
